Trousseau's syndrome triggered by an immune checkpoint blockade in a non-small cell lung cancer patient.

PD-1 blockade therapy activates T cells by blocking the interaction between PD-1 and PD-L1 and promotes IFN-γ and Th1 cytokine production. In turn, IFN-γ and Th1 cytokines produced by activated T cells promote TF synthesis in monocytes/macrophages, which results in hypercoagulability leading to thrombosis.
